L10n regressions from reorg bug 1765629
Categories
(Thunderbird :: Build Config, defect)
Tracking
(thunderbird_esr102 fixed, thunderbird108 fixed)
People
(Reporter: rjl, Assigned: rjl)
References
(Regression)
Details
(Keywords: regression)
Attachments
(2 files)
48 bytes,
text/x-phabricator-request
|
wsmwk
:
approval-comm-beta+
wsmwk
:
approval-comm-esr102+
|
Details | Review |
48 bytes,
text/x-phabricator-request
|
wsmwk
:
approval-comm-beta+
|
Details | Review |
- The Macedonian (mk) localized build is missing. It should be built for Daily only
Assignee | ||
Updated•2 years ago
|
Assignee | ||
Comment 1•2 years ago
|
||
- The l10n_pre job isn't properly using "by-release-type" in the transform that resolves it. Always resolves to "all-locales", this will be a problem on beta.
Assignee | ||
Comment 2•2 years ago
|
||
Always used the default value before.
Updated•2 years ago
|
Assignee | ||
Comment 3•2 years ago
|
||
The locales list needs to be different for release/beta builds, but that isn't
permitted by gecko_taskgraph. Some of the transforms for shippable-l10n need to
run before the gecko_taskgraph transforms, others after. This is handled by
creating two TransformSequence objects in a single file and arranging the kind
configuration accordingly.
The result is "locales-file" is now keyed by release-type.
Depends on D162313
Assignee | ||
Comment 4•2 years ago
|
||
Comment on attachment 9303929 [details]
Bug 1801150 - Fix resolving by release-type for "locale-list" field in l10n-pre. r=dandarnell
[Approval Request Comment]
Regression caused by (bug #): 1765629
User impact if declined: Incorrect localized builds on beta/release
Testing completed (on c-c, etc.): should be on nightly soon
Risk to taking this patch (and alternatives if risky):
Assuming 1765629 is uplifted, this is needed to fix the regressions
Request is for D162313 & D162314.
Assignee | ||
Updated•2 years ago
|
Pushed by thunderbird@calypsoblue.org:
https://hg.mozilla.org/comm-central/rev/9f9683bb0b79
Fix resolving by release-type for "locale-list" field in l10n-pre. r=dandarnell
https://hg.mozilla.org/comm-central/rev/91e1e511f8e4
Set l10n locales-file to resolve based on release-type. r=dandarnell
Comment 6•2 years ago
|
||
Comment on attachment 9303930 [details]
Bug 1801150 - Set l10n locales-file to resolve based on release-type. r=dandarnell
[Triage Comment]
Approved for beta
Comment 7•2 years ago
|
||
Comment on attachment 9303929 [details]
Bug 1801150 - Fix resolving by release-type for "locale-list" field in l10n-pre. r=dandarnell
[Triage Comment]
Approved for beta
Comment 8•2 years ago
|
||
bugherder uplift |
Thunderbird 108.0b2:
https://hg.mozilla.org/releases/comm-beta/rev/8398f9f980ad
https://hg.mozilla.org/releases/comm-beta/rev/e024d1fe8ee7
Updated•2 years ago
|
Assignee | ||
Updated•2 years ago
|
Assignee | ||
Comment 9•2 years ago
|
||
Comment on attachment 9303929 [details]
Bug 1801150 - Fix resolving by release-type for "locale-list" field in l10n-pre. r=dandarnell
[Approval Request Comment]
Fixes for bug 1765629
Comment 10•2 years ago
|
||
Comment on attachment 9303929 [details]
Bug 1801150 - Fix resolving by release-type for "locale-list" field in l10n-pre. r=dandarnell
[Triage Comment]
approved for esr102
Assignee | ||
Comment 11•2 years ago
|
||
bugherder uplift |
Description
•